About you
We’re looking for an enthusiastic, positive and driven team lead for our SALT team.
Recognised professional qualification
Registered member of RCSLT and HCPC
Qualification in clinical education for undergraduate SALT students
Post basic dysphagia qualification
Experience of working with adults with learning disabilities and autism
The post holder will be responsible for development of the SALT service to ensure a high standard of communication assessment and intervention to students at Bridge College and other individuals accessing the service. The post holder will provide assessment, intervention and monitoring for students with learning disabilities and autism spectrum conditions and will support other members of the SALT team to effectively manage their caseloads. The post holder also will have a lead role in the management of dysphagia across the college.
They will work in close collaboration with parents and other professionals within and outside the college. Safeguarding children and vulnerable people is a priority for all employees.

About Bridge College
Bridge College is the Together Trust’s specialist education college for students aged 16 to 25 years with disabilities, complex needs and autism. Bridge College promotes a multidisciplinary approach to learning and has expertise in supporting students with a wide range of needs.
